Bhutanese culture truly glows during its annual Tshechus – vibrant spiritual festivals filled with masked dances, ancient rituals, and incredible pageantry. Several Tshechus are scheduled across the country, each offering a unique perspective on Bhutanese heritage. For case, the Paro Tshechu, a large event, promises an unforgettable experience with its colorful procession of dancers and the unveiling of the gigantic Thongdrel painting. Preparing Your Bhutan Festival Trip: 2026 Dates
Planning a journey to the Kingdom of Bhutan in 2026? You’re in for a truly unforgettable experience! Bhutanese festivals, or *tsechus*, are vibrant showcases of cultural dance, spiritual music, and colorful masked performances. This guide will provide you with confirmed dates and a glimpse into what to expect from some of the most prominent celebrations. Keep in mind that dates can occasionally shift, so it's always wise to double-check with your tour operator or the Bhutanese Tourism Board closer to your travel time. The Paro Tshechu typically takes place in April, with spectacular displays that draw crowds from across the globe. Similarly, the Thimphu Tshechu, a significant event, generally unfolds in September. Other notable festivals to consider include the Wangdue Phodrang Tshechu in April and the Bumthang Jambay Lhakhang Drup, a unique and highly regarded spiritual experience held in October. Don't forget that attending these festivals requires a pre-arranged tour package through a licensed Bhutanese operator.
